DraftKings, FanDuel Daily Fantasy Basketball Picks (12/1/23): Today's Top NBA DFS Lineups

Nikola Jokic - NBA DFS Lineup Picks, Betting Picks, Daily Fantasy Basketball

The top daily fantasy basketball lineup picks for DraftKings and FanDuel on December 1st, 2023. Mike Barner provides NBA DFS analysis and sleeper picks for building optimal DFS rosters.

The NBA brings a limited schedule Friday that will consist of only six games. There is the potential for some blowouts, including when the Pelicans host the Spurs and when the Magic take on the Wizards.

In terms of injuries, Kristaps Porzingis (calf) will remain out for the Celtics. Notable players who are listed as questionable include Joel Embiid (illness), Devin Booker (ankle), and Jamal Murray (ankle).

DraftKings and FanDuel Guards - NBA DFS Lineup Picks

Cole Anthony, ORL vs. WAS – PG/SG ($7,000 DK; $6,900 FD)

Anthony is locked in right now. Over the last eight games, he has averaged 18.5 points, 5.5 rebounds, and 5.1 assists. Not only did he shoot 46.7 percent from the field during that stretch, but he also logged 29 minutes per game. Markelle Fultz (knee) is out again, so expect Anthony to remain in an expanded role.

Jalen Suggs, ORL vs. WAS – PG/SG ($6,200 DK; $5,900 FD)

This should be a popular night to deploy players from the Magic in DFS. The Wizards have played at the second-fastest pace and have the third-worst defensive rating in the league. When Suggs faced them Wednesday, he produced 22 points, three rebounds, three assists, and two steals across 29 minutes. He should also benefit from Fultz being sidelined.

Derrick Rose, MEM at DAL – PG/SG ($4,900 DK; $4,800 FD)

The Grizzlies have been hammered by injuries. When they brought in Rose during the offseason, it wasn’t with the intent of playing him significant minutes. They have had no choice lately, which has left Rose to log at least 20 minutes in three straight games. During that stretch, he averaged 14.3 points, 2.7 rebounds, and 4.7 assists. Given his cheap salaries on both sites, he’s at least worth considering in tournament play.

DraftKings and FanDuel Forwards - NBA DFS Lineup Picks

Kevin Durant, PHX vs. DEN – PF ($9,900 DK; $10,200 FD)

It’s not difficult to make an argument for rolling with Durant in DFS whenever the Suns are in action. With his averages of 31.3 points, 6.9 rebounds, 5.5 assists, and 1.1 blocks, he carries an extremely high floor. He has only had one game all season in which he has scored fewer than 25 points, and that came in the Suns’ season opener. One of the main reasons for his success is that he is shooting 51.8 percent from the field and 89.6 percent from the charity stripe.

Franz Wagner, ORL vs. WAS – SF ($7,800 DK; $7,700 FD)

The Wizards had no answer Wednesday for Wagner, who scored 31 points on 11-for-14 shooting from the field. While he normally isn’t that efficient, he is shooting 46.8 percent from the field for the season. With at least 27 points in three of his last four games, it’s difficult to envision the defensively-challenged Wizards being able to slow him down in this rematch.

David Roddy, MEM at DAL – SF/PF ($4,700 DK; $4,600 FD)

The Grizzlies made a change to their starting five in their last game Wednesday against the Jazz. They benched Santi Aldama, replacing him with Roddy. Roddy went on to log 25 minutes, producing 19 points and six rebounds along the way. If he starts again, his cheap salary make him a viable option in tournament play.

DraftKings and FanDuel Centers - NBA DFS Lineup Picks

Nikola Jokic, DEN at PHX – C ($12,400 DK; $12,700 FD)

Jokic already has seven triple-doubles this season. He has missed recording four others by just one assist each. Not only that, but he is averaging 29.0 points per game, which is on pace to be the highest mark of his career. The center position isn’t exactly loaded for this six-game slate, which might make it even more worthwhile to pay up for Jokic’s hefty salary.

Jaren Jackson Jr., MEM at DAL – C/PF ($8,000 DK; $8,000 FD)

A positive for the Grizzlies is that Jackson has not missed any games because of injury. He is averaging a career-high 32 minutes per game because of all of their depth issues, and that’s not likely to change anytime soon. In his expanded role, he has provided 19.5 points, 6.1 rebounds, 1.9 assists, 1.8 blocks, and 1.4 three-pointers per game. The Mavericks don’t have a ton of size up front, making this a matchup that Jackson could potentially exploit.

Dereck Lively II, DAL vs. MEM – C ($4,900 DK; $5,200 FD)

The Mavericks must be thrilled with the initial returns from Lively. The 19-year-old rookie quickly moved into the starting lineup, which has enabled him to average 8.1 points, 7.5 rebounds and 1.1 blocks per game. He is a perfect lob option for Luka Doncic, which has helped him shoot 71.1 percent from the field. With the Grizzlies dealing with so many injuries up front, Lively has the potential to provide value.
